World’s Portable Bluetooth Speaker Buying Guide

Sound Quality

Sound quality is paramount for any speaker. It dictates how enjoyable your music or podcasts will be. A good portable speaker should offer clarity, balance, and sufficient volume without distortion.

When looking at specs, pay attention to driver size and frequency response. Larger drivers generally produce richer bass. A wide frequency range (e.g., 50Hz-20kHz) ensures you hear both deep lows and crisp highs. Consider reviews that mention sonic characteristics like warmth, detail, and imaging.

Battery Life and Portability

For a portable speaker, battery life is crucial. You want a device that can last through a picnic, a day at the beach, or a long road trip without needing a recharge. Portability also encompasses size, weight, and durability.

Look for speakers offering at least 10-15 hours of playback on a single charge. Features like IP ratings (e.g., IPX7 for water resistance) are vital for outdoor use. Consider the speaker’s form factor and how easy it is to carry in a bag or even a pocket.

Connectivity and Features

Seamless connectivity is essential for a frustration-free experience. Bluetooth version is a key spec, with newer versions like Bluetooth 5.0 offering better range and stability. Some speakers also offer multi-point pairing or the ability to link multiple speakers for stereo sound.

Think about additional features that enhance usability. A built-in microphone for speakerphone calls, app control for EQ settings, or even wireless charging can add significant value. Check for auxiliary input ports if you have non-Bluetooth devices.

Durability and Build Quality

A portable speaker is likely to encounter some rough handling. Its build quality and durability will determine its longevity and ability to withstand the elements and accidental drops.

Look for robust materials like reinforced plastics, metal grilles, and rubberized coatings. Water and dust resistance (IP ratings) are highly recommended for outdoor adventures. Check reviews for comments on how well the speaker holds up over time and in various conditions.

Frequently Asked Questions

What Is the Best Portable Bluetooth Speaker for Bass Lovers?

For deep bass, seek speakers with larger drivers. Look for models advertised with a focus on low-end response. Check frequency response specs for lower Hz numbers.

Brands often highlight their bass performance. Read reviews specifically mentioning bass impact and fullness. Some speakers have passive radiators for enhanced bass output. Consider a speaker with a dedicated bass boost feature.

How Important Is Water Resistance for a Portable Speaker?

Water resistance is very important if you plan to use the speaker outdoors. This includes near pools, at the beach, or during light rain. It protects the speaker from damage.

Look for an IP rating. IPX7 means it can be submerged in water for a short time. IP67 offers both dust and water resistance. This feature provides peace of mind.

Can I Connect Two Portable Bluetooth Speakers Together?

Yes, many modern portable speakers offer stereo pairing. This allows you to link two identical speakers. You get a much wider soundstage. It enhances the listening experience significantly.

Check the product specifications for ‘TWS’ (True Wireless Stereo) or ‘stereo pairing’ functionality. This feature is common in higher-end models. It’s great for parties or immersive listening.

How Long Should the Battery on a Portable Bluetooth Speaker Last?

A good portable Bluetooth speaker should offer at least 10-15 hours of playback. Many premium models can last 20-30 hours or more. This ensures it lasts a full day of use.

Battery life depends on volume and features used. Lower volumes conserve power. Check manufacturer claims and user reviews for real-world performance. Some speakers offer fast charging.

What Is the Difference Between Bluetooth Versions?

Newer Bluetooth versions offer better performance. Bluetooth 5.0 and later provide extended range and faster pairing. They also consume less power.

Higher versions improve connection stability. This means fewer dropouts. Look for at least Bluetooth 4.2. Bluetooth 5.0 or 5.1 is ideal for a seamless experience.
